Military Strength: China vs United States

Overview

United States (ranked #1 globally) holds a stronger overall military position than China (#2) on the Global Military Index. China fields 2,535,000 active troops vs 1,395,000 for United States, backed by 510,000 reserves and 1,500,000 paramilitary. United States's $920B defense budget is 3.3x that of China ($281B).

In the air, China operates 3,497 aircraft including 2,043 combat jets, while United States fields 12,784 with 3,101 fighters.

At sea, China's 1023-ship navy outnumbers United States's 243 vessels, including 61 and 71 submarines respectively. On the ground, China deploys 6,800 main battle tanks vs 4,640 for United States.

Both are nuclear powers: China maintains 600 warheads and United States holds 5,042.

Frequently Asked Questions

Who has more military personnel, China or United States?
China has approximately 2,535,000 active military personnel compared to United States's 1,395,000, giving China a 1.8:1 numerical advantage.
Which country has more combat aircraft, China or United States?
United States operates 3,101 combat aircraft compared to China's 2,043. This includes fighters, strike aircraft, and multirole combat jets.
Who has the larger navy, China or United States?
China has a larger navy with 1023 vessels compared to United States's 243 ships. China operates 61 submarines while United States has 71.
Which country spends more on defense, China or United States?
United States has a larger defense budget at $920.0 billion (3:1 more) compared to China's $281.2 billion annually.
Do China and United States have nuclear weapons?
Yes, both China and United States possess nuclear weapons. China has approximately 600 nuclear warheads while United States has 5,042.
How do the tank forces of China and United States compare?
China operates 6,800 main battle tanks compared to United States's 4,640. Tank numbers reflect both active inventory and reserves.
